It's OK to move your plant from a location where it's getting all the time complete sun, to a spot that provides shade for half the day, due to the fact that it's still permitting some sun. If you were to completely shade out the plant throughout the day for an amount of time, it's going to have to be re-acclimated to sun later. A Shade fabric is a woven material that is generally comprised of polyester materials. They can trap heat in, so if utilizing for a greenhouse, it's finest to utilize shade fabric made of polyethylene. Aluminet is likewise an excellent choice for greenhouses.

This product almost imitates acting like a reflective mirror - Growfoodguide.com. Here is a breakdown of the 3 major kinds of shade fabrics: -A woven shade fabric can be a little heavier than other materials and is made from woven polypropylene product. These sort of shade fabrics are more geared towards greenhouse usage and can last as much as 12 years. They appear more plastic like and tend to be more sturdy, however included a higher expense. Normally lighter weight then other varieties of shade fabric which can make it simpler to work with. Knitted shade clothes tend to come in more color versions aside from the basic black.

They normally can last as much as 10 years. -This category of shade cloth has actually become progressively more popular. Again, it's going to be more for patios, greenhouses, or big structures, versus a little raised garden bed. Aluminet is more efficient with keeping both light levels down along with temperature level. Because it's reflective and doesn't take in, it can help keep plants cooler. Aluminet is also very resilient. A percentage is frequently associated with the shade fabric ranging from 5% -95%. This designates the quantity of sun light the shade fabric deflects. So for a 95% shade fabric, a plant would be getting 5% of the sunlight that it would get without a shade cloth present.

If the fabric is curtained directly on the plant it can trigger the leaves to burn or trap excessive heat in. You wish to have some air flow under the shade cloth. It's finest to build or use some sort of structure over the plant or tree to create a canopy with the shade cloth. I utilize four wood stakes around my fruit tree and drape the fabric over top of the 4 posts. In our extreme desert sun, it's better to go a bit higher with the portion. I've had excellent success utilizing 30-50% shade cloth on much of my young fruit trees or plants that have actually required some sun relief.

On my young, while it was getting developed the first couple years, I made use of 80% shade. It likewise was planted in a place that it gets some afternoon shade without a fabric. So, a lot depends upon the type of plant or fruit tree, along with the age. What are some Tips for Protecting Plants from Heat? If you know that a plant or fruit tree is more sensitive to sun, then plant them in areas of your yard that already has some recognized shade from other big trees, structures, or how that spot faces the sun. Take a look at my post on the. When plants are young they are working hard to establish root systems. During this time any added stress, like intense sun, can cause the plant to battle. It can be beneficial to plant in an area that enables the plant to establish initially while slowly growing into full sun.
